Job Description

BUSINESS FUNCTION: People
SALARY: £61,064 - £68,218 / Grade: ML2/SB2
ROLE TYPE: Permanent
LOCATION: Leeds/Manchester
HOURS: 37 per week

Every Northern journey starts with our people, and behind the scenes, thousands of colleagues keep our railway moving every day, from drivers and conductors to engineers and support teams.

As our People Strategy & Improvement Manager, you’ll play a key role in shaping how we deliver our People strategy and continually improve the way our People function supports the business. You’ll help turn strategy into action — ensuring the right programmes, projects and improvements are delivered in a way that genuinely makes life better for our colleagues.

Working closely with the people leadership team, you’ll lead the programme management of our People Plan and drive continuous improvement across the employee experience — making sure our processes are simple, effective and built around the needs of the people who use them.

What you’ll be doing

You’ll sit at the centre of our People strategy delivery, helping to connect teams, drive progress and keep momentum across a wide range of initiatives.

Y

ou’ll:

  • Lead programme management of Northern’s People Strategy, ensuring key initiatives are delivered successfully across the function
  • Build and maintain clear programme roadmaps, tracking milestones, risks, benefits and interdependencies
  • Work with project leads and senior stakeholders to keep projects on track and delivering real value
  • Support the People Leadership Team by providing insight, coordination and progress reporting
  • Drive the continuous improvement of HR processes, ensuring they’re efficient, consistent and easy for colleagues and managers to use
  • Use data and colleague feedback to identify improvement opportunities across the employee journey
  • Embed a culture of continuous improvement across People Services
  • Coach and support colleagues across the People function in project delivery and process improvement

About you

You’ll be someone who enjoys bringing structure and clarity to complex programmes, while keeping people at the heart of everything you do.

You’ll likely have:

  • Experience managing programmes or projects in HR, People or organisational change
  • A track record of improving HR processes or services to enhance employee experience
  • Strong stakeholder management and influencing skills
  • Experience using data and insight to drive decision-making and improvement
  • Knowledge of project management methodologies (such as PRINCE2 or Agile)
  • Familiarity with continuous improvement approaches like Lean or Six Sigma
  • The confidence to work with senior leaders while collaborating across teams

Most importantly, you’ll be passionate about creating an environment where colleagues can do their best work every day.

What’s in it for you?

At Northern, we don’t just value our people - we go the extra mile to support them. Here’s a taste of what you can look forward to:

Free Travel: Unlimited free travel for you, your partner, and your dependents on Northern services. Plus up to 75% discount on other networks in the UK and Europe.

Generous Pension Scheme: We top up your contributions by 1.5 times.

Enhanced Family Benefits: We offer 9 months of full pay for maternity leave and 2 weeks for paternity leave.

Cycle to Work Scheme: Save up to 42% on a bike and spread the cost.

Electric Car Scheme: Lease a brand new electric or plugin hybrid car.

Exclusive Discounts: From shopping to wellbeing, Northern Perks has you covered.

Employee Assistance Programme: 24/7 support for family, lifestyle, and more.

Training and Career Development: We offer tailored training to our colleagues and opportunities to gain recognised qualifications. Plus enhanced career pathways no matter what part of the business you’re in.

Recognition: We know how important it is to show how much we appreciate our people. That’s why we have our Northern Lights and Northern Sparks Awards, recognising and celebrating brilliance every day.
